Who lives here?

Woodbine Heights, Toronto is a central Toronto neighbourhood notable for its executives and business, science and education, law & public sector professionals. Residents tend to be older with a significant number of babies, kids aged 5 to 9, adults aged 35 to 64 and seniors aged 65 to 69.
